  Element Count Trivia
 
"2,172 is the total of different moulded elements in 1999. There are 97 LEGO PRIMO elements, 399 LEGO DUPLO elements, 157 LEGO SCALA elements, 903 LEGO SYSTEM elements, 357 LEGO TECHNIC elements and 137 LEGO DACTA elements – and that’s not counting (...)
